from typing import Optional, List
from agents.agent import Agent
from agents.deals import ScrapedDeal, DealSelection, Deal, Opportunity
from agents.scanner_agent import ScannerAgent
from agents.ensemble_agent import EnsembleAgent
from agents.messaging_agent import MessagingAgent
class PlanningAgent(Agent):
name = "Planning Agent"
color = Agent.GREEN
DEAL_THRESHOLD = 50
def __init__(self, collection):
"""
Create instances of the 3 Agents that this planner coordinates across
"""
self.log("Planning Agent is initializing")
self.scanner = ScannerAgent()
self.ensemble = EnsembleAgent(collection)
self.messenger = MessagingAgent()
self.log("Planning Agent is ready")
def run(self, deal: Deal) -> Opportunity:
"""
Run the workflow for a particular deal
:param deal: the deal, summarized from an RSS scrape
:returns: an opportunity including the discount
"""
self.log("Planning Agent is pricing up a potential deal")
estimate = self.ensemble.price(deal.product_description)
discount = estimate - deal.price
self.log(f"Planning Agent has processed a deal with discount ${discount:.2f}")
return Opportunity(deal=deal, estimate=estimate, discount=discount)
def plan(self, memory: List[str] = []) -> Optional[Opportunity]:
"""
Run the full workflow:
1. Use the ScannerAgent to find deals from RSS feeds
2. Use the EnsembleAgent to estimate them
3. Use the MessagingAgent to send a notification of deals
:param memory: a list of URLs that have been surfaced in the past
:return: an Opportunity if one was surfaced, otherwise None
"""
self.log("Planning Agent is kicking off a run")
selection = self.scanner.scan(memory=memory)
if selection:
opportunities = [self.run(deal) for deal in selection.deals[:5]]
opportunities.sort(key=lambda opp: opp.discount, reverse=True)
best = opportunities[0]
self.log(f"Planning Agent has identified the best deal has discount ${best.discount:.2f}")
if best.discount > self.DEAL_THRESHOLD:
self.messenger.alert(best)
self.log("Planning Agent has completed a run")
return best if best.discount > self.DEAL_THRESHOLD else None
return None
